Fiona

Introducing Fiona—the tiny queen of the litter!

Miss Fiona is equal parts sweetheart and boss lady. She loves being cuddled, carried, and spoiled like the princess she believes she is, but don’t let that fool you—this girl can also keep her brothers in line! Confident and independent, Fiona has a nurturing side that shines through in everything she does.

When she’s excited, Fiona bounces around the yard like a happy little bunny, bringing joy and laughter everywhere she goes. She has the perfect mix of playful energy and loving affection.

Fiona came to Dogworks after a heartbreaking beginning. Born on St. Patrick’s Day, she and her siblings lost their mama shortly after birth. Thanks to dedicated rescuers and an amazing foster home, Fiona has been bottle-fed and lovingly raised since her very first days.

DogWorks Inc. Canine Rescue and Placement's Adoption Policy
Dogworks strives to place dogs into permanent homes based on the dogs' personalities and yours. To adopt a dog, we require a completed application, signed adoption contract, and home visit. Applications can be submitted online, by mail, or in person at adoption events. Once your application has been submitted, we will contact your references and consider suitability. You will be contacted by phone or email, typically within 4 business days, to make arrangements for adoption. If a particular dog is not placed with you, it does not mean that your application has been rejected. Dogworks receives multiple applications for some dogs. Foster families always have the first option to adopt. We do not approve applications on a first come basis as we strive for placement that is best for the dog and adoptive family. The home environment, family composition and yard are very important considerations in our decision to place a dog in a home. Some dogs do not do well with young children or cats, and our hounds require a fenced yard as examples of our decision process. Adoption fees are variable (typically $125-$500.00) and are listed with the description of each dog. All fees collected are used to cover rescue expenses, including foster care and veterinary expenses. Adoption fee will be refunded if you decide that the dog is not compatible with your family within 2 weeks. All dogs have received age appropriate vaccinations, GI dewormer, and heartworm test prior to adoption if they are old enough. Adult dogs and puppies older than 12 weeks are spayed/neutered. Adopters of younger puppies may be required to sign an agreement to complete spay/neuter by 5 months of age. We will assist with spay/neuter costs. All of our dogs and puppies will be microchipped prior to adoption. Adopters will receive a copy of medical records when adoption contract has been signed and adoption fees have been paid in full. Requirements for adoption: Please be aware that your adoption application WILL NOT be approved by Dogworks unless ALL of these criteria are met: >Adopters must be within a one hour radius of Toledo. >Adopters must be at least 21 years of age. >Veterinary reference must be positive. >All dogs in the home must be spayed/neutered. >All members of the household must be in agreement to adopt. >Individual needs of the dog must be met in prospective home (e.g., fully fenced yard for all hounds). Our Mission
Dogworks is an all-volunteer, nonprofit group based in Toledo, OH, whose purpose is to rescue, rehabilitate, and re-home abandoned, neglected, and unwanted dogs.
